CITY OF KENAI
RESOLUTION NO. 2011 -36
A RESOLUTION OF TH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F KENAI, ALASKA, AUTHORIZING
A BUDGET TRANSFER WITHIN THE GENERAL FUND, NON - DEPARTMENTAL AND
LAND ADMINISTRATION DEPARTMENTS FOR EXTERNAL LEGAL SERVICES TO
REVIEW A PROPOSED LAND, SUB - SURFACE RIGHTS AGREEMENT BETWEEN THE
CITY AND COOK INLET NATURAL GAS STORAGE ALASKA (CINGSA).
WHEREAS, the City's FY11 insurance expenditures are
budgeted; and,
21,500 less than previously
WHEREAS, the savings from insurance is available for redirection to other needs; and,
WHEREAS, the Administration has received a sub - surface mineral rights agreement
from CINGSA and seeks review by Council with expertise in this subject; and,
WHEREAS, the cost for this review is estimated at $7,500.00.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F KENAI,
ALASKA, the following budget transfers be made:

MEMO:
TO: City Council
FROM: Rick Koch
DATE: April 28, 2011
SUBJECT: Resolution 2011 -36
The purpose of this correspondence is to recommend Council approval of Resolution No. 2011-
36 authorizing a budget transfer within the General Fund, in the amount of $7,500, to provide
funding for external specialty legal services for the review of sub - surface rights agreements
between the City and Cook Inlet Natural Gas Storage Alaska (CINGSA).
In order that appropriate due diligence is exercised to protect the rights and future potential
value of City sub - surface estates the Administration requires the legal services of a
firm /individual specializing in this field.
CINGSA has agreed to reimburse the City for these attorney's fees to a maximum of $7,500, the
amount estimated to accomplish the work.
